Ralph W. Kuncl is a scholar working on Neurology, Molecular Biology and Cellular and Molecular Neuroscience. According to data from OpenAlex, Ralph W. Kuncl has authored 83 papers receiving a total of 10.4k indexed citations (citations by other indexed papers that have themselves been cited), including 43 papers in Neurology, 32 papers in Molecular Biology and 22 papers in Cellular and Molecular Neuroscience. Recurrent topics in Ralph W. Kuncl's work include Amyotrophic Lateral Sclerosis Research (21 papers), Peripheral Neuropathies and Disorders (14 papers) and Muscle Physiology and Disorders (9 papers). Ralph W. Kuncl is often cited by papers focused on Amyotrophic Lateral Sclerosis Research (21 papers), Peripheral Neuropathies and Disorders (14 papers) and Muscle Physiology and Disorders (9 papers). Ralph W. Kuncl collaborates with scholars based in United States, Japan and Italy. Ralph W. Kuncl's co-authors include Jeffrey D. Rothstein, Lee J. Martin, Margaret Dykes‐Hoberg, Allan I. Levey, Jin Li, Lynn A. Bristol, Yanfeng Wang, Devin Welty, Carlos A. Pardo and Matthias A. Hediger and has published in prestigious journals such as New England Journal of Medicine, Proceedings of the National Academy of Sciences and Neuron.
